Valencia Colleges, Inc. (VCI) has taken a progressive step in enhancing science and mathematics education through the formal signing of a Memorandum of Understanding (MOU) with Experience Science (SciApp). As part of this partnership, VCI secured two (2) units of the 3D Vector Apparatus, an innovative instructional tool designed to support experiential and visualization-driven learning in physics. This milestone reflects the institutionโ€™s continued commitment to providing quality education through the integration of modern and effective teaching resources.

The acquisition of the 3D Vector Apparatus enables educators to deliver more interactive and engaging lessons, particularly in topics involving vectors, motion, and spatial relationships. By incorporating hands-on learning strategies, VCI aims to deepen studentsโ€™ conceptual understanding and improve overall learning outcomes. The collaboration also opens opportunities for teacher training and capacity building, ensuring that instructors are well-equipped to maximize the use of the apparatus in the classroom.

๏ฟฝThe 3D Vector Apparatus is a hands-on educational tool designed to demonstrate vector concepts such as magnitude, direction, and vector components in three-dimensional space. It enables teachers and students to visualize how vectors behave in real time, making complex ideas in physics and mathematics easier to understand through interactive and experiential learning.
